Hurt Right Top Of Head. Iced It Immediately. Hurts To Bend, Touch. Matter Of Concern?

Last evening I was taking dishes out of the dishwasher. I stood up and hit the front right top of my head on the corner of a cabinet door. I put ice on immediately for around 10 minutes. It doesn't hurt unless I touch the spot (slight abrasion, no blood), but when I bend over, my head throbs at the point of injury. Is this something that should go away in a couple of days, or should I be more concerned. I did not have any symptoms of a concussion.

As there was blunt injury to head , so this developed contusion ( hematoma ) . When there is bending , you feel pain, this is a natural thing.
In my opinion nothing to worry wait for few days and you will be alright .
In my opinion no X ray , no any test .
Rest and wait are good for you. Dr. HET
